    i am an artflow user i have some questions
    why every arist fillup his whole character in to grey before colouring it? whts the purpose of it nd why its necessary?

      Hey Sameer! You don't have to fill your character silhouette in grey or another color as part of your process.. but it does come with a few benefits. First it makes you aware of any blank areas you may have forgotten to add color to, you can also alpha lock or add clipping masks to make coloring faster and finally some artists find it helpful for tonal control of their colors and shading when they start with a neutral grey color.
      Regarding your question for Artflow, you have to keep in mind Artflow is developed by a small team in comparison to Procreate. They are very different apps and drawing experiences. Artflow does allow you to add texture to your brushes but the options are limited. Also you can't import brushes from Photoshop, Clip Studio or Procreate directly into Artflow. Instead you have to recreate those brushes in Artflow's brush creator.
